More than 144 killed as 7.9 magnitude earthquake hits Nepal.



    A powerfu 7.9 magnitude earthquake struck near Kathmandu, the Nepal's capital. The powerful earthquake left more than 114 people dead, as the violently shaking earth collapsed houses and triggered avalanches in the Himakiyas. An iconic 19th century tower, the Dgarara tower, in the capital turned into a pile if rubble and Nepalese online media reported that many people were trapped there. The epicentre was 80km northwest of Kathmandu. The Kathmandu valley is about 2.5 million population. The injured werw being treated outside hospital in chaotic services. The after shocks were felt in India northern part and New Delhi as well as in Bangladesh. Casualties figures is expected to increase.
